Things to know about commercial truck insurance

- Coverage Types: Commercial truck insurance typically includes various types of coverage, such as liability coverage (covering damages to others), physical damage coverage (covering damage to your truck), cargo coverage (covering the goods you transport), and more specialized coverage like environmental liability or trailer interchange.
- Requirements: Commercial truck insurance is often legally mandated, with minimum coverage requirements varying by jurisdiction. Proof of insurance is typically required to operate a commercial truck legally.
- Cost Factors: Several factors influence the cost of commercial truck insurance, including the driver’s record, the value and type of truck, the cargo being transported, the distance and routes traveled, and the coverage limits chosen. A clean driving record and experience can lower premiums, while high-risk factors can increase them.
- Deductibles and Premiums: Like personal insurance policies, commercial truck insurance policies typically involve deductibles (the amount you pay out-of-pocket before insurance kicks in) and premiums (the periodic payments to maintain coverage). Higher deductibles generally lead to lower premiums, but this increases the out-of-pocket expense in case of a claim.
- Specialized Coverage: Depending on the nature of your business, you may need specialized coverage beyond standard policies. For example, if you transport hazardous materials, you’ll need coverage for spills or environmental damage. If you operate across state lines or internationally, you might require coverage that complies with interstate or international regulations.
Commercial truck insurance is crucial for protecting your assets and ensuring legal compliance.
